CVE-2022-44796
CRITICAL · CVSS 9.8
EPSS exploitation probability: 0%
Published 2022-11-07T04:15:09.600 · Last modified 2026-06-17T05:08:56.873

Summary

An issue was discovered in Object First Ootbi BETA build 1.0.7.712. The authorization service has a flow that allows getting access to the Web UI without knowing credentials. For signing, the JWT token uses a secret key that is generated through a function that doesn't produce cryptographically strong sequences. An attacker can predict these sequences and generate a JWT token. As a result, an attacker can get access to the Web UI. This is fixed in Object First Ootbi BETA build 1.0.13.1611.
